Effects of surgery on mucosal pathologic changes following experimental sinusitis in rabbit

Summary
This study in rabbits shows that while surgery improves sinusitis, persistent inflammation can occur near the sinus opening after middle meatal antrostomy (MMA). This highlights the complex interplay of bacteria, inflammation, and surgical site in chronic sinusitis.

Purpose of the Study:
- To evaluate the regenerative potential of infected maxillary sinus mucosa after surgical interventions in a rabbit model.
- To compare the histopathological outcomes of middle meatal antrostomy (MMA) and modified radical operation (MRO) in treating induced sinusitis.
- To investigate the role of bacterial pathogens (Staphylococcus aureus, Bacteroides fragilis) and surgical techniques in sinus mucosa regeneration.
Main Methods:
- Induction of sinusitis in rabbits via ostial occlusion with or without bacterial inoculation.
- Performance of surgical procedures: middle meatal antrostomy (MMA) and modified radical operation (MRO).
- Histological examination and semiquantitative grading of the entire nose-sinus complex in treated and untreated groups.
Main Results:
- Both MMA and MRO surgeries reduced overall sinus mucosa inflammation compared to untreated sinusitis.
- Persistent local histopathology, particularly in the ostial region, was noted after MMA surgery.
- Surgical intervention alone, without addressing ostial pathology, showed limitations in complete mucosal healing.
Conclusions:
- Surgical interventions for sinusitis can reduce inflammation but may not fully resolve local pathology, especially in the ostial area.
- The interaction between bacterial colonization, host inflammation, and surgical manipulation at the ostial site is critical in chronic sinusitis.
- Further research into optimizing surgical techniques to address local ostial changes is warranted for improved patient outcomes.
